예제 #1
0
        private void Visualizar()
        {
            FormProfessor frmProfessor = new FormProfessor();

            frmProfessor.SetOperacao(TipoOperacaoCadastro.Visualizar, GetIdItemSelecionado(lstProfessores));

            frmProfessor.ShowDialog(this);
        }
예제 #2
0
        private void Excluir()
        {
            FormProfessor frmProfessor = new FormProfessor();

            Professor professor = null;

            frmProfessor.SetOperacao(TipoOperacaoCadastro.Excluir, GetIdItemSelecionado(lstProfessores));

            frmProfessor.SetEventRetorno(new EventHandler <Professor>(delegate(Object o, Professor a)
            {
                professor = a;
            }));

            frmProfessor.ShowDialog(this);

            if (professor != null)
            {
                RemoveItemSelecionado(lstProfessores);
            }
        }
예제 #3
0
        private void Incluir()
        {
            FormProfessor frmProfessor = new FormProfessor();

            Professor professor = null;

            frmProfessor.SetOperacao(TipoOperacaoCadastro.Incluir, 0);

            frmProfessor.SetEventRetorno(new EventHandler <Professor>(delegate(Object o, Professor a)
            {
                professor = a;
            }));

            frmProfessor.ShowDialog(this);

            if (professor != null)
            {
                lstProfessores.BeginUpdate();

                IncluirNovoItem(professor);

                lstProfessores.EndUpdate();
            }
        }